IVPConfig::IsVPDecimationAllowed (Windows Embedded CE 6.0)

1/6/2010

This method determines if scaling at the video port is possible.

Syntax

HRESULT IsVPDecimationAllowed(
  LPBOOL pbIsDecimationAllowed
);

Parameters

  • pbIsDecimationAllowed
    [out] Pointer to TRUE if decimation is allowed, and to FALSE otherwise.

Return Value

Returns an HRESULT value that depends on the implementation of the interface.

HRESULT can include one of the following, or other values not listed.

Value Description

E_FAIL

Failure.

E_POINTER

NULL pointer argument.

E_INVALIDARG

Invalid argument.

E_NOTIMPL

Not implemented.

NOERROR

No error.

Remarks

The Overlay Mixer filter uses this function to determine whether the driver needs the mixer to decimate video data at its own discretion.

This function can be especially useful in a capture with preview situation in which you would not want the VP mixer filter to perform any scaling at the video port.
